Reps to cut down salaries by 50% for 6 months to support hardship

DailyblastBy DailyblastJuly 18, 202401 Min Read
Share WhatsApp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email Telegram Copy Link
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email WhatsApp Copy Link

The House of Representatives on Thursday, July 18, resolved to support the Federal Government with N648 million for six months by cutting down their salaries by 50% to support food sufficiency across the country and to address the high cost of food.

This followed the adoption of an amendment to a motion’s prayer moved by the Deputy Speaker of the House, Benjamin Okezie Kalu, on the need for lawmakers to sacrifice 50% of their N600,000 monthly salaries to support Nigerians given the hardship in the land.

Kalu’s amended prayer was to a motion by Rep Isiaka Ayokunle calling on proponents of the planned nationwide protests to jettison the idea and engage the government in dialogue. 

The Deputy Speaker said the salary cut is to be used to support the federal government’s efforts to address the rising cost of foodstuffs in the country with the view to ameliorating the hardship Nigerians are going through.

By slashing their salaries by 50%, the 360 lawmakers will be sacrificing N108 million monthly for the next six months. 

The motion was adopted and referred to the committees on Humanitarian Affairs, Finance and Budget for compliance.
